1. From Descriptive to Predictive and Prescriptive Analytics
Traditional data analysis focused on what happened in the past. AI changes this by enabling businesses to anticipate what will happen next and what they should do about it.
The evolution looks like this:
Descriptive analytics: What happened?
Diagnostic analytics: Why did it happen?
Predictive analytics: What is likely to happen?
Prescriptive analytics: What should we do about it?
AI models can now process vast datasets to identify patterns that humans would miss, enabling faster and more accurate forecasting across marketing, sales, and operations.
2. Real-Time Data Processing and Decision Making
One of the biggest advantages of AI in data analysis is speed. Businesses are no longer waiting for monthly reports or manual dashboards.
Modern AI systems enable:
Real-time performance tracking
Instant anomaly detection
Live customer behaviour insights
Automated alerts for business-critical changes
Tools like Google Analytics have already moved toward real-time reporting, but AI takes this further by interpreting data automatically and recommending actions.
3. AI-Powered Business Intelligence Tools
Business intelligence platforms are evolving rapidly with AI integration, making advanced analytics more accessible to non-technical users.
Platforms such as Tableau and Microsoft Power BI are increasingly incorporating machine learning features that:
Suggest insights automatically
Highlight trends and outliers
Generate natural language summaries
Enable predictive dashboards
This shift is democratising data, allowing teams across marketing, operations, and leadership to make data-driven decisions without relying solely on analysts.
4. Natural Language Interfaces and Conversational Analytics
One of the most significant shifts in AI-driven data analysis is the move toward natural language interaction.
Instead of writing complex queries, users can now ask questions like:
“What were our top-performing campaigns last quarter?”
“Why did conversion rates drop last week?”
“Which customer segments are growing fastest?”
Large language models such as ChatGPT are already enabling this type of conversational analytics, making data exploration more intuitive and accessible across organisations.
5. Predictive Personalisation at Scale
AI is also transforming how businesses use data to personalise customer experiences.
By analysing behaviour patterns, AI can:
Predict customer intent
Recommend products or services in real time
Personalise marketing messages at scale
Improve retention through targeted engagement
This level of personalisation was previously impossible without significant manual segmentation and effort.
6. The Role of Human Insight in an AI-Driven World
Despite rapid advancements, AI does not replace human analysts, it enhances them.
Human expertise remains essential for:
Defining business context and goals
Interpreting nuanced insights
Ensuring ethical use of data
Making strategic decisions based on AI outputs
The future lies in collaboration between human intelligence and machine intelligence, not replacement.
